Appsmith is a platform to build admin panels, internal tools, and dashboards. Prior to 2.1, the bundled Caddy reverse-proxy's admin API — which has no authentication by default — is bound on 0.0.0.0:2019 inside the container. While this listener is not directly published to the host by docker-compose.yml, it is reachable from the Appsmith server process itself or a SSRF vulnerability. An authenticated low-privileged user can therefore drive the SSRF to issue POST /load (or any other admin-API call) against http://0.0.0.0:2019/, fully replacing the live Caddy configuration and taking over the reverse proxy. This vulnerability is fixed in 2.1.
